About SDU

Suleyman Demirel University (SDU) — private non-profit university. It is located in Almaty, Kazakhstan. The higher education institution was founded not so long ago — in 1996 — which is why it is considered one of the youngest in the country.

SDU conducts various scientific activities and is inviting students to join the research.

SDU tuition fees

The academic calendar at SDU is divided into two semesters. For convenience, tuition fees are calculated per year. Tuition fees at SDU are different for locals and foreigners. Kazakhstan citizens pay 6 USD per year, while international students pay a minimum of 5,000 USD. Thanks to financial support programs, students have the opportunity to fully or partially cover the cost of education. The exact cost of programs and information on the availability of scholarships can be found on the website of the university.

In addition to the cost of education, it is necessary to pay attention to additional costs: accommodation, transportation, study materials, meals and personal expenses.

SDU campus

The campus of the educational institution is suburban. The advantages of such a location include the ability to quickly get to the city, access to various types of recreation (in nature and in the city) and a close-knit student community. The school has a library where students can do their homework or just relax. SDU regularly invites foreign students to participate in exchange programs. For locals, this is a unique opportunity to get in touch with the cultures of other countries, meet representatives of different nationalities and make friends around the world.
